Question 1016940: You have received test scores of 83, 75, 81, and 74 recently. You have to get a B- 80%average for the course. What must your fifth and final test score be to get this average?

For 5 scores to average 80, they must total 400, as 5*80=400
83+75+81+74+X=400
X=87

Total for first 4 tests:-
83 + 75 + 81 + 74
= 313
To get an average of 80 for fifth
and final test
Total must be 5 x 80
= 400
So, 400 - 313 = 87
A test score of 87 is required
to get an average of 80 overall.
